Kutztown University is seeking two (2) athletic communications graduate assistants for the 2026-27 academic year. The graduate assistants will assist the department's director of athletic communications and assistant director of athletic communications with coverage of the Golden Bears' 23 NCAA Division II varsity athletic programs. Individuals will be responsible for comprehensive website management, including feature stories, event previews and recaps, updating scores, statistics, rosters and schedules, and program archives. There will also be game management duties, to include score table and press box management, operating in-game scoring statistical programs and postgame score reporting. Additionally, the graduate assistants will serve as the primary contact for select sports as assigned by the director of athletic communications, and assist with oversight of Kutztown's official athletics social media platforms and the creation of engaging content for each. The graduate assistants will be required to work hours associated with the athletic communications profession, including nights and weekends.

REQUIRED FOR APPOINTMENT

Bachelor's degree

Accepted into one of Kutztown University's graduate programs, which can be found by clicking here

Registered as a full-time matriculating graduate student (9 or more credits per semester)

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

Working knowledge of the athletic communications profession and a wide range of collegiate sports

Knowledge of Blueframe/HudlTV Production Truck, NCAA LiveStats/PrestoStats/StatCrew statistical software and the SIDEARM Sports web management platform

Experience with design software such as Adobe InDesign and Photoshop, BoxOut and Canva is preferred

Previous experience with photography and video equipment is helpful, but not required
